What is Tor and How Does It Work?

Understanding Tor

Tor is like a secure tunnel that helps you browse the internet anonymously. It works by redirecting your internet traffic through a series of volunteer-operated servers, making it difficult for anyone to trace your online activities back to you. Imagine Tor as a secret passage that hides your identity while you navigate through it.

How Tor Changes Your IP Address

When you use Tor, your IP address gets masked behind multiple layers of encryption, similar to wearing a series of disguises. Each server in the Tor network peels off one layer, making it challenging for websites or online services to determine your real IP address. It's like going undercover in the digital world, keeping your true identity hidden.

Using Python to Automate IP Address Changes

Automating the Process with Python

Python is a versatile programming language that allows you to automate tasks with ease. By combining Python with Tor, you can create scripts that automatically change your IP address at set intervals. This can be useful for web scraping, security testing, or accessing region-locked content.

Steps to Change Your IP Address Using Python and Tor

  1. Install the requests library in Python to send web requests.
  2. Set up and configure the stem library in Python to control Tor.
  3. Write a Python script that sends a request through Tor to change your IP address.
  4. Run the script to automate the process of changing your IP address.

Security Tips for Using Tor and Python Safely

Protecting Your Privacy

  • Always keep your Tor browser up to date to benefit from the latest security features.
  • Avoid entering personal information or logging into accounts while using Tor to maintain anonymity.

Securing Your Python Scripts

  • Regularly review your Python scripts to ensure they are not leaking any sensitive information.
  • Be cautious when downloading Python libraries from untrusted sources to prevent malware infections.

By following these security tips and understanding how Tor and Python work together, you can safely change your IP address and navigate the internet more securely.
